MCP Intercom Server

import { z } from "zod"; import { IntercomClient } from "../api/client.js"; export const GetConversationsSchema = z.object({ startDate: z.string().optional(), endDate: z.string().optional(), customer: z.string().optional(), state: z.string().optional(), }); export const SearchConversationsSchema = z.object({ createdAt: z .object({ operator: z.enum(["=", "!=", ">", "<"]), value: z.number(), }) .optional(), updatedAt: z .object({ operator: z.enum(["=", "!=", ">", "<"]), value: z.number(), }) .optional(), sourceType: z.string().optional(), state: z.string().optional(), open: z.boolean().optional(), read: z.boolean().optional(), // Add more filters as needed }); export async function searchConversations( args: z.infer<typeof SearchConversationsSchema> ) { const client = new IntercomClient(); const params: Parameters<typeof client.searchConversations>[0] = {}; if (args.createdAt) { params.createdAt = args.createdAt; } if (args.updatedAt) { params.updatedAt = args.updatedAt; } if (args.sourceType) { params.sourceType = args.sourceType; } if (args.state) { params.state = args.state; } if (args.open) { params.open = args.open; } if (args.read) { params.read = args.read; } const { conversations } = await client.searchConversations(params); return conversations.map((conv) => ({ id: conv.id, created_at: new Date(conv.created_at * 1000).toISOString(), updated_at: new Date(conv.updated_at * 1000).toISOString(), state: conv.state, priority: conv.priority, contacts: conv.contacts.map((contact) => ({ name: contact.name, id: contact.id, })), })); } export async function listConversationsFromLastWeek() { // Calculate last week's date range const client = new IntercomClient(); const now = new Date(); const lastWeekStart = new Date(now); lastWeekStart.setDate(now.getDate() - 7); lastWeekStart.setHours(0, 0, 0, 0); const lastWeekEnd = new Date(lastWeekStart); lastWeekEnd.setDate(lastWeekStart.getDate() + 6); lastWeekEnd.setHours(23, 59, 59, 999); // Convert to Unix timestamp (seconds) const startTimestamp = Math.floor(lastWeekStart.getTime() / 1000); const endTimestamp = Math.floor(lastWeekEnd.getTime() / 1000); return client.searchConversations({ createdAt: { operator: ">", value: startTimestamp, }, updatedAt: { operator: "<", value: endTimestamp, }, }); } // export async function getConversations( // args: z.infer<typeof GetConversationsSchema> // ) { // const client = new IntercomClient(); // const params: Parameters<typeof client.getConversations>[0] = {}; // if (args.startDate) { // params.startDate = new Date(args.startDate); // } // if (args.endDate) { // params.endDate = new Date(args.endDate); // } // if (args.customer) { // params.customer = args.customer; // } // if (args.state) { // params.state = args.state; // } // const { conversations } = await client.getConversations(params); // return conversations.map((conv) => ({ // id: conv.id, // created_at: new Date(conv.created_at * 1000).toISOString(), // updated_at: new Date(conv.updated_at * 1000).toISOString(), // state: conv.state, // priority: conv.priority, // contacts: conv.contacts.map((contact) => ({ // name: contact.name, // id: contact.id, // })), // statistics: { // responses: conv.statistics.responses, // reopens: conv.statistics.reopens, // }, // })); // }
